Performance Metrics: Analyzing Data Transfer Rates Across USB Types

When you're picking out the right USB connectors for your setup, it's pretty important to get a handle on the performance stuff — mainly, the data transfer speeds. I mean, not all USBs are created equal. You've got USB 2.0, USB 3.0, and then USB-C, and each of these offers different speeds and features. For example, USB 2.0 maxes out at about 480 Mbps, which is okay for some things, but USB 3.0 can push up to 5 Gbps. Then there's USB 3.1 and USB-C, which can go even faster — over 10 Gbps! So, knowing what you actually need based on these stats helps a ton when you're deciding what to go with.

Future Trends in USB Technology: What to Expect in Upcoming Standards

As technology keeps evolving, USB standards are also advancing to keep up with what users and manufacturers really need. One of the biggest trends we're seeing right now is the push towards USB4. It promises much faster data transfer speeds and better power delivery—pretty exciting stuff! Built on the Thunderbolt 3 architecture, USB4 can hit data rates of up to 40 Gbps, which makes it perfect for high-performance gadgets like external SSDs and large displays. As more devices start using this standard, you’ll find that everything just works together more smoothly, with wider compatibility across different systems.

And then there’s USB-C—this little connector is truly becoming the universal standard. Its reversible design and multi-functionality mean it can do a lot more than your old USBs ever could. As manufacturers keep adopting USB-C, it means less hassle for us—just a single port that handles data transfer, charging, and even video out. Plus, with the rise of power delivery tech, USB-C is making fast charging a reality for everything from smartphones to laptops. FAQS

: What are the data transfer rates for different USB types?

: USB 2.0 supports transfer rates up to 480 Mbps, USB 3.0 can reach up to 5 Gbps, and USB 3.1 and USB-C can exceed speeds of 10 Gbps.

Why is it important to consider device compatibility with USB connectors?

Compatibility is crucial to avoid performance bottlenecks, as both the host and peripheral devices must support the same USB standard for optimal performance.

What additional specifications should be considered beyond speed when choosing USB connectors?

It's important to consider power delivery and data integrity, especially for devices that require higher power output, such as laptops and smartphones.

What is USB Power Delivery (USB PD)?

USB Power Delivery is a feature that enables higher power output, allowing devices to charge faster and perform better, essential for devices like laptops and smartphones.

What is the significance of USB4 in future technology trends?

USB4, built on Thunderbolt 3 architecture, promises data transfer speeds of up to 40 Gbps and improved power delivery, making it well-suited for high-performance devices.
